Window service providers offer a range of solutions to maintain, repair, and improve the windows in residential properties. These services often include replacing broken or damaged glass, upgrading old window units, and sealing gaps to prevent drafts. Whether a homeowner needs to fix a cracked pane or wants to enhance energy efficiency, experienced contractors can handle these tasks efficiently. Proper window care not only improves the appearance of a home but also helps in maintaining indoor comfort and reducing utility costs.

Many common problems can be addressed through window services. For instance, windows that are difficult to open or close may have issues with hardware or frame alignment. Foggy or cloudy glass often indicates seal failure, which can compromise insulation and lead to higher heating and cooling costs. Additionally, deteriorating seals or rotting frames can cause leaks, drafts, and water intrusion. Service providers can assess these issues and recommend the appropriate repairs or replacements to restore the functionality and appearance of the windows.

The overview below groups typical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in North Attleboro, MA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ine window repairs in North Attleboro range from $100 to $300, covering tasks like replacing broken glass or fixing minor hardware issues. Many small jobs fall within this range, especially for single-pane repairs or minor adjustments.

Standard Window Replacement - Replacing an individual window or installing new units generally costs between $300 and $800 per window. Most projects in this category are mid-scale and fall within this range, depending on window size and material choices.

Full Window Replacement - Complete replacement of multiple windows or larger projects can range from $2,000 to $6,000 or more, especially when upgrading to energy-efficient or custom designs. Larger, more complex jobs tend to push into the higher end of this spectrum.

Custom or Specialty Installations - Specialty windows, such as bay or bow styles, or custom designs, typically cost $5,000 and up for entire projects. These projects are less common and often involve higher costs due to complexity and materials used.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
